diff options
author | Jonathan D. Turner <jonathan.d.turner@gmail.com> | 2011-06-03 23:11:16 +0000 |
---|---|---|
committer | Jonathan D. Turner <jonathan.d.turner@gmail.com> | 2011-06-03 23:11:16 +0000 |
commit | 205c7d559fe10661aa470d245da7dddd1af8233f (patch) | |
tree | eb3af64c8f4d44cfb1c181d64ff84f4cc6a1d284 /clang/lib/Serialization/ASTWriter.cpp | |
parent | 4cd65962dc2a807c6dca2e0f8d8c84f92a1a4155 (diff) | |
download | bcm5719-llvm-205c7d559fe10661aa470d245da7dddd1af8233f.tar.gz bcm5719-llvm-205c7d559fe10661aa470d245da7dddd1af8233f.zip |
Improvements to abbreviations for PCH which add support for EnumDecl, ObjCIvarDecl, TypedefDecl, VarDecl and FieldDecl and improve support for ParmVarDecl.
llvm-svn: 132604
Diffstat (limited to 'clang/lib/Serialization/ASTWriter.cpp')
-rw-r--r-- | clang/lib/Serialization/ASTWriter.cpp |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/clang/lib/Serialization/ASTWriter.cpp b/clang/lib/Serialization/ASTWriter.cpp index 89a6b7606e0..194d6c31cfa 100644 --- a/clang/lib/Serialization/ASTWriter.cpp +++ b/clang/lib/Serialization/ASTWriter.cpp @@ -2703,11 +2703,13 @@ ASTWriter::ASTWriter(llvm::BitstreamWriter &Stream) NumStatements(0), NumMacros(0), NumLexicalDeclContexts(0), NumVisibleDeclContexts(0), FirstCXXBaseSpecifiersID(1), NextCXXBaseSpecifiersID(1), - ParmVarDeclAbbrev(0), DeclContextLexicalAbbrev(0), + DeclParmVarAbbrev(0), DeclContextLexicalAbbrev(0), DeclContextVisibleLookupAbbrev(0), UpdateVisibleAbbrev(0), DeclRefExprAbbrev(0), CharacterLiteralAbbrev(0), DeclRecordAbbrev(0), IntegerLiteralAbbrev(0), - EnumConstantDeclAbbrev(0) + DeclTypedefAbbrev(0), + DeclVarAbbrev(0), DeclFieldAbbrev(0), + DeclEnumAbbrev(0), DeclObjCIvarAbbrev(0) { } |